#73135c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#73135c is composed of 45.1% red, 7.5% green and 36.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 83.5% magenta, 20% yellow and 54.9% black. It has a hue angle of 314.4 degrees, a saturation of 71.6% and a lightness of 26.3%. #73135c color hex could be obtained by blending #e626b8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660066.

Shades and Tints of #73135c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e020b is the darkest color, while #fffcf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#73135c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#454144 is the less saturated color, while #820464 is the most saturated one.
